The Best Way to Watch: NBA League Pass India
If you are a hardcore fan who does not want to miss a single second of the action, the NBA League Pass is your ultimate solution. In India, the NBA has made significant efforts to make this service affordable and accessible. Unlike the US version, which can be quite expensive, the Indian version of the League Pass is priced competitively to suit the local market. You can choose between a monthly subscription or an annual pass. The biggest advantage of the League Pass is that it gives you access to every single Oklahoma City game, including the playoffs, without any blackouts. You also get access to classic games, documentaries, and studio analysis. For an Indian viewer, this means you can watch the game live early in the morning or catch the full replay later in the day if you happen to sleep through the 5:30 AM tip-off.

Free and Affordable Streaming via JioCinema
For those who may not want to commit to a paid subscription immediately, JioCinema has become a game-changer for Indian sports fans. As the official digital partner for the NBA in India, JioCinema broadcasts several live games throughout the week for free. While they might not show every single Oklahoma City Thunder game, they frequently feature high-profile matchups involving the team, especially when they are playing against big-market teams like the Lakers or the Warriors. The app is available on almost all platforms, and the best part is that you do not necessarily need a Jio SIM card to access the content anymore. The streaming quality is generally high-definition, and it works remarkably well even on mobile data, which is a huge plus for Indian viewers on the move.
Television Broadcast: Sports18
If you prefer the traditional experience of watching sports on a large television screen through a cable or DTH connection, Sports18 is the channel to tune into. Owned by Viacom18, this channel is the linear home for the NBA in India. They broadcast a selection of games live every week. To ensure you catch Oklahoma City, you will need to check the weekly schedule provided by your cable operator or follow the official NBA India social media handles. Watching on Sports18 is ideal for families who like to enjoy sports together without worrying about internet lag or data caps. Most major DTH providers like Tata Play, Airtel Digital TV, and Dish TV carry Sports18 in both SD and HD formats.
Understanding the Time Zone Challenge
One of the biggest hurdles for an Indian fan wanting to watch Oklahoma City is the Indian Standard Time (IST) difference. Most NBA games take place in the evening in the United States, which translates to early morning hours in India. For Oklahoma City home games, tip-off times usually fall between 5:30 AM and 7:30 AM IST. This requires a bit of a lifestyle adjustment. Many dedicated Indian fans have developed a routine of waking up early to catch the second half of the game before heading to work or college. If you cannot manage the early morning starts, the NBA App and JioCinema both offer condensed highlights and full game replays, allowing you to stay updated with the Thunder’s progress without sacrificing your sleep.

Is NBA League Pass free in India?
No, the NBA League Pass is a paid subscription service in India. However, it is offered at a much more affordable price compared to other regions, and there are often promotional discounts available throughout the season.
Can I watch Oklahoma City Thunder games for free on JioCinema?
Yes, JioCinema broadcasts a selection of NBA games for free. While they do not show every single Oklahoma City game, they frequently feature them in their live broadcast schedule.
What time do Oklahoma City games usually start in India?
Most Oklahoma City Thunder home games start between 5:30 AM and 7:30 AM Indian Standard Time (IST), depending on the specific tip-off time in the US Central Time zone.
Which TV channel shows NBA games in India?
Sports18 is the official television broadcaster for NBA games in India. You can check your local cable or DTH listings for the specific channel number and broadcast schedule.
